Millennium Management LLC increased its holdings in shares of Crane (NYSE:CR - Free Report) by 31.3%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 136,009 shares of the conglomerate's stock after purchasing an additional 32,393 shares during the period. Millennium Management LLC owned approximately 0.24% of Crane worth $20,834,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Crane (NYSE:CR -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Monday, July 28th. The conglomerate reported $1.49 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.34 by $0.15. Crane had a net margin of 13.10% and a return on equity of 24.45%. The business had revenue of $577.20 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$567.70 million.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$1.20 earnings per share. The company's revenue was up 9.2% on a year-over-year basis. Crane has set its FY 2025 guidance at 5.500-5.800 EPS. On average, analysts forecast that Crane will post 7.87 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Crane Company Profile

(Free Report)

Crane Company,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ells engineered industrial products in the United States, Canada, the United Kingdom, Continental Europe, and internationally. The company operates in three segments: Aerospace & Electronics, Process Flow Technologies, and Engineered Materials.
